主要职责:
1、负责微信小程序的前端开发,使用*******框架高效、高质量地完成业务需求。
2、开发和维护基于Vue 3和TypeScript的复杂Web应用,确保代码的可维护性、可扩展性和高性能。
3、解决移动端兼容性适配问题,深刻理解各机型的差异和特性,并提供优雅的兼容方案。
4、负责小程序与智能硬件设备(通过TCP协议)的通信功能开发与联调,确保数据传输的稳定性和可靠性。
5、与产品经理、设计师及后端工程师紧密协作,参与产品需求讨论,定义技术方案,并推动项目顺利上线。
职位要求(必需):
1、精通 Vue.js 及其核心生态(Vuex/Pinia, Vue Router, Vite等),有3年及以上Vue商业化项目开发经验。
2、熟练掌握 TypeScript,具备在大型项目中运用TS进行类型设计和开发的实战经验。
3、深入掌握 ******* 框架,拥有实际的*******开发微信小程序并成功上线的项目经验,熟悉其生命周期、条件编译及性能优化。
4、具备小程序与TCP设备(如智能硬件、物联网设备)通信的实战经验,了解TCP Socket连接、数据传输、心跳包等基本概念。
加分项:
1、有开发多端应用(如H5、支付宝小程序等)的经验。
2、熟悉小程序云开发、微信开放能力(登录、支付、分享等)。
3、前端工程化经验,熟悉CI/CD、Webpack/Vite配置、代码规范管理等。
说明:岗位为外包,长期稳定